Burlington Media’s marketing ops, CRM and data executive will support the contact data systems and marketing business areas for BMG. The role centres on:
- Managing and optimising the customer relationship management (CRM) system (Salesforce) and ensuring data quality and freshness both in the CRM and interconnected systems, including our EMS (ActiveCampaign) and our own proprietary data platform, Unicorn.
- Being the business expert in our CRM platform, including training staff and leveraging reporting functionality to help the whole business make the most of our data.
- Delivering ops, data and CRM strategies aimed at nurturing relationships and increasing engagement with market and client audiences to drive signups, subscriptions, event attendance, advertising and event sponsorship.
- Ensuring that demographic, firmographic and technographic data is accurately maintained in Salesforce to add value to business activities and to Unicorn, and to improve content and marketing engagement, drive subscription renewals, event registrations, and support sales efforts.
- Closely support the customer success and sales functions in reporting back to clients the success of work we do.
Key responsibilities
- Martech management: Maintain and manage the company’s CRM system, acting as our Salesforce power user, and ensuring that all data is accurate, up-to-date, and (with the wider marketing team) segmented/tagged appropriately for effective targeting and for use in the business’s connected systems (such as Unicorn).
- Assist the head of marketing with overseeing the management of our overall marketing tech stack, to feed the wider business with better data, better outcomes, and more efficient and useful processes.
- Lead continuous improvement in the data structure, data quality and data accessibility across the business, primarily for the CRM but also for all systems we rely on.
- Collaborate with internal teams to ensure the CRM system is used effectively across the business, including setting up workflows, automated processes, and reporting.
- Regularly audit the CRM database to ensure data integrity and compliance with GDPR and other relevant regulations.
- Maintain and develop any connections and data flows between the CRM and external systems and data providers.
Cross-team collaboration:
- Work closely with the sales, marketing, and events teams to ensure CRM efforts are aligned with business objectives and customer needs.
- Ensure the CRM system supports the sales pipeline, helping the sales team track and manage leads, sponsorship/sales opportunities and contact interaction tracking, and delivering highest-quality reporting and reporting support for the commercial side of the business.
- Liaise with our IT and martech‑related suppliers to troubleshoot any technical issues and recommend system improvements or enhancements.
- Perform data analytics and reporting work for the content team around market research surveys throughout the year.
Martech training and support:
- Provide training and support to internal teams on best practices for using the CRM system and our marketing automation tools, especially data input and reporting.
- Ensure that all team members are trained in and confident using the CRM system effectively to meet their individual and departmental goals.
- Stay informed on CRM software updates and best practices, advising on new features or tools that can improve business processes and implementing any necessary updates (with input from our external consultants where needed).
Customer data analysis and segmentation:
- Create (with the marketing and audience engagement team) segmented customer lists for targeted marketing campaigns based on behaviour, demographics, interests, and past interactions with the magazine brands and events.
- Work with sales and marketing colleagues to develop a clear understanding of customer segments (eg subscribers, attendees, sponsors).
Marketing campaign support and execution:
- Assist with email list segmentation and maintenance, and with LinkedIn PPC targeting and exclusion lists.
- Set up and manage automated marketing workflows within email marketing tools (to nurture leads, encourage subscription renewals, and promote upcoming events).
Marketing data analysis and reporting:
- Assist the marketing leads in reporting on the performance of marketing campaigns using analytics tools (Google Analytics, email marketing and social media reporting etc) to evaluate success and inform future strategies.
- Continuously improve our marketing reporting capabilities through tool choice and dashboard creation/development and integration.
- Prepare regular reports/create the templates or capability for staff to report on key performance metrics such as audience growth, campaign ROI, event registrations, lead generation, customer health.
- Work with the wider marketing team to use data‑driven insights to optimise marketing efforts and improve audience targeting, engagement, and conversion rates.
Unicorn business unit support:
- Manage and process GDPR compliance emails for the business, most of which will relate to Unicorn, updating any opted‑out contacts.
- Work with the Unicorn Product Manager to optimise data structure and flows between the CRM and Unicorn.
